Do you need a permit to carry a gun in St Louis?
Missouri allows open carry without a permit, so long as the firearm is not displayed in an angry or threatening manner. Some localities prohibit open carry; however, concealed carry license holders are exempted from this restriction.
Where do I get my concealed weapons permit in Missouri?
Missouri has a shall-issue policy for CCW permits done at the local sheriff’s level. In Missouri, you can only apply for resident permits. Non-residents permits are for just members of the armed forces that posted to the state. But the state has a permitless policy, and you do not require a license to possess firearms.
Can I carry a gun in my car without a permit in Missouri?
According to Missouri gun law, any person who is at least 19 years-of-age and not otherwise prohibited from possessing a firearm can transport a concealable firearm in the passenger compartment of a motor vehicle. No concealed carry permit is required.

Can anyone open carry in Missouri?
Open Carry is legal without a permit but local governments can ban the open carrying of firearms without a valid permit Missouri issues or honors. The state preemption statute only covers the carrying of concealed firearms so local authorities can ban the carrying of firearms openly without a valid permit.
